Transaction 118feee9030fc3d4ddab2bf5bfb422d963dfbeee3747089523915bdca72ec9ca
1 Input
1 Output
-
118feee9030fc3d4ddab2bf5bfb422d963dfbeee3747089523915bdca72ec9ca:0
- value
- 142609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c07b4e104dcce0981f51f90d30839680a105020a OP_EQUAL
- address
- 3KEmNkbCjzCESSRBanZvnRvXGNzHpDwXg5